If you want me to resend, I would just replace the second paragraph in patch 1 with the following: --- On MDM9607 and other recent SoCs, the QPIC hardware requires 3 clocks (ahb, core, aon). However, the access to these clocks is restricted to the RPM firmware that controls the shared power resources for the whole SoC. The clocks cannot be controlled separately, there is only a single RPM_SMD_QPIC_CLK clock that implicitly enables all of the 3 clocks. The only exception to this are some IPQ* SoC that are not using RPM, there the clocks are directly controlled by the kernel via the clock controller (GCC).
